ERF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
180 of the 3,756 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Enerplus Corporation (ERF)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$706M — up 159% from $272M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 43 funds opened new ERF positions and 19 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 48 added to existing stakes and 57 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Letko, Brosseau & Associates, adding an estimated $44.4M. The largest seller was Bank of Montreal, cutting an estimated $7.14M.
